The Tale of Rufus and the Golden Carrot

Once upon a time, in a forest where trees shrouded in perpetual verdancy stood as an endless expanse, danced a harmonious ballet of intertwining branches, lived a quiet, timid creature named Rufus. Rufus was a rabbit, the most unassuming of all its brethren. His abode, a snug burrow amid the twisting roots of a gigantic oak. More than anything, Rufus dreamed of embarking on adventures in search of the legendary 'Golden Carrot.'
Each day, as the first rays of sunshine pierced through the leafy canopies, bathing the forest floor with a radiant glow, Rufus played with fellow animals, heard stories of bravery from the elderly owl, and gorged on delectable carrots plucked right out of the heart of Mother Nature. However, he was never truly content. The dream of the 'Golden Carrot' consumed him. As per the legend, the carrot was hidden deep within the forest ensconced by perilous obstacles but promised unimaginable power and wisdom.
One day, Rufus decided to chase his dream and ventured deep into the forest. Before leaving, the wise owl warned him of the dangerous road ahead, setting his one golden watchful eye on him with a grim expression that could curdle milk.
As Rufus embarked on his journey, his path was immediately obstructed by a gushing river with ferocious currents that would boisterously challenge his resolve. Shrugging off fear, he built a sturdy raft using twigs and leaves, showing ingenuity and resilience. He sailed across the tumultuous river, his heart beating thunderously against his furry chest. A sense of achievement was accompanied by the realization of his inherent courage.
His journey continued as he stumbled upon a mountain of thorns, a barrier that seemed impossible to conquer. The sight of the blood-thirsty spikes could daunt the bravest of the brave. However, small as Rufus was, a determination to reach his dream overpowered his fear. He spotted a little opening and like an audacious explorer, scuttled through the tunnel of thorns with minor scrapes. Pain was transient, but the pride of overcoming the barrier left a permanent mark on his spirit.
Emerging from the tunnel, Rufus was encountered by a massive serpent guard, the guardian of the 'Golden Carrot.' The serpent's demeanor was as chilling as an unfathomable abyss, its gaze as toxic as its venom. Leveraging his quick-witted nature, Rufus distracted the serpent with a group of scurrying mice and successfully dodged it.
Finally, there it was, the 'Golden Carrot,' in all its dazzling glory, atop a lush hillock. With triumph swelling in his chest, Rufus sprinted toward it. As he grasped it, a surge of vitality flowed through him. His eyes, filled with wisdom, reflected the golden hue. He comprehended the power of perseverance, bravery, and intelligence. He achieved more than a legendary artifact. He discovered his true allegiance to courage over comfort. The forest celebrated his victory, looking at him with newfound respect.
His journey back home was accompanied by enthusiasm. The once timid rabbit had transformed into a legend. He was greeted with cheers and applause. To everyone's surprise, Rufus placed the 'Golden Carrot' in the center of the forest, signifying it as a beacon of wisdom and courage. Rufus became the story of legends, inspiring every creature to conquer their fears and pursue their dreams fearlessly.
